Pennsylvania Statutes

§ 8110 — Debt statement

Pennsylvania·Title 53 MUNICIPALITIES GENERALLY·Part PART VII·Ch. 81 INCURRING DEBT AND ISSUING BONDS AND NOTES·Subch. GENERAL PROVISIONS
(a)General rule.--Before delivering any general obligation bonds or notes or guaranteed revenue bonds or notes constituting nonelectoral debt or before executing an instrument evidencing lease rental debt, the officer or officers of a local government unit shall prepare and verify under oath a debt statement as of a date not more than 60 days before the filing with the department or, in the case of notes issued under section 8109 (relating to small borrowing for capital purposes), before the final adoption of the resolution authorizing their issue, showing:
